New Fed Chair Unveils Major Policy Reforms, Ends Forward Guidance
Federal Reserve Chairman Kevin Warsh has introduced significant operational reforms, including the abolition of forward guidance and his personal Summary of Economic Projections. While the FOMC maintained interest rates, policymakers' median projection now suggests a rate hike this year, indicating a hawkish shift amid rising inflation expectations. Markets responded with a sell-off in risk assets and an increase in the dollar and Treasury yields.
